人工智能(Artificial Intelligence,AI)逐渐成为推动社会进步的重要力量。人工智能编程作为AI领域的关键技术,为人类开启了智能时代的创新之门。本文将从人工智能编程的起源、发展、应用以及未来展望等方面进行探讨,以期为读者提供一幅人工智能编程的生动画卷。
一、人工智能编程的起源与发展
1. 人工智能编程的起源
人工智能编程起源于20世纪50年代,当时计算机科学家们开始探索如何让计算机具备人类的智能。1956年,美国达特茅斯会议上,约翰·麦卡锡等学者提出了“人工智能”这一概念,标志着人工智能编程的正式诞生。
2. 人工智能编程的发展
自1956年以来,人工智能编程经历了多个发展阶段:
(1)知识工程阶段:20世纪60年代至70年代,人工智能编程以知识表示和推理为核心,代表性技术为专家系统。
(2)机器学习阶段:20世纪80年代至90年代,人工智能编程转向机器学习,通过数据驱动的方法实现智能。
(3)深度学习阶段:21世纪初至今,人工智能编程以深度学习为核心,实现了在图像识别、语音识别、自然语言处理等领域的突破。
二、人工智能编程的应用
1. 图像识别
图像识别是人工智能编程在计算机视觉领域的重要应用。通过深度学习技术,计算机能够自动识别图像中的物体、场景等信息,广泛应用于安防监控、自动驾驶、医疗影像等领域。
2. 语音识别
语音识别是人工智能编程在语音处理领域的重要应用。通过深度学习技术,计算机能够将语音信号转换为文字,广泛应用于智能客服、智能家居、语音助手等领域。
3. 自然语言处理
自然语言处理是人工智能编程在语言理解领域的重要应用。通过深度学习技术,计算机能够理解和生成自然语言,广泛应用于智能问答、机器翻译、情感分析等领域。
4. 机器人技术
机器人技术是人工智能编程在智能硬件领域的重要应用。通过编程,机器人能够实现自主导航、感知环境、执行任务等功能,广泛应用于工业生产、服务机器人、娱乐机器人等领域。
三、人工智能编程的未来展望
1. 跨学科融合
人工智能编程将继续与其他学科融合,如生物学、心理学、社会学等,以实现更全面的智能。
2. 智能化水平提升
随着技术的不断发展,人工智能编程将实现更高的智能化水平,为人类提供更便捷、高效的服务。
3. 应用领域拓展
人工智能编程的应用领域将不断拓展,覆盖更多行业和领域,为人类社会带来更多创新。
人工智能编程作为开启智能时代的创新之门,具有广泛的应用前景。随着技术的不断发展,人工智能编程将在各个领域发挥越来越重要的作用,为人类社会带来更多福祉。让我们共同期待人工智能编程的未来,共同书写智能时代的辉煌篇章。